说一点儿:
在sysLib.c中,sysHwInit()会调用ppc860IntrInit(),来完成对外部中断系统的初始化。
在ppc860IntrInit()中,主要部分就是将ppc860IntrDeMux()挂接到外部中断0x500;而将ppc860CpmIntrDeMux()与SIU的某个中断挂接;指定三个中断API函数的实体;
在有中断发生时,会跳转到0x500处;ppc860IntrDeMux()会根据中断号调用不同的服务函数;但如果是CPM的中断,ppc860IntrDeMux()会调用ppc860CpmIntrDeMux(),来处理CPM中断。